Advanced Leak Detection Approaches
Detecting leaks early can help homeowners avoid costly and time-consuming repairs. Various effective techniques exist for identifying leaks within a home. One common method involves visual inspections, where homeowners look for water stains, moisture patches, or mold development on walls and ceilings. In addition, keeping an eye on water bills for unusual rises can point to unseen leaks.
One more practical approach utilizes utilizing a moisture meter, which has the ability to measure heightened moisture levels in structural materials. For more advanced detection, acoustic leak detection makes use of dedicated microphones to identify the noise of water escaping through pipes. Infrared cameras can also be utilized to detect temperature discrepancies that might reveal concealed leaks behind wall surfaces.
Additionally, hydraulic pressure testing can effectively detect leaks in plumbing systems by measuring the pressure drop in the pipes. Implementing these techniques helps homeowners resolve leaks in a timely manner, preventing more extensive damage and costly repairs down the line.

What Are the Warning Signs of a Hidden Leak?
Evidence of a hidden leak includes water discoloration on walls or ceilings, an abrupt spike in water bills, damp or mildew odors, and the noise of flowing water when all fixtures are turned off.
How Do I Keep My Pipes from Freezing in Winter?
To prevent frozen pipes in winter, homeowners are advised to add insulation to exposed pipes, maintain adequate heat in the home, let faucets drip at a slow rate, and keep cabinet doors open to allow warm air to flow. Consistent upkeep is also critical for the best possible protection.
What Plumbing Tools Should Every Homeowner Have?
Every homeowner should possess essential plumbing equipment such as a plunger, heavy-duty pipe wrench, versatile adjustable wrench, sink basin wrench, plumber's tape, and a drain snake. These tools enable efficient upkeep and small-scale repairs, promoting a well-functioning home plumbing system.
